摘要
In this paper, a novel tri-material gate (TMG) FinFET device is proposed. Using three-dimensional (3-D) device simulator, hot-carrier effects and short-channel effects of TMG FinFET are investigated and compared with that of dual-material gate FinFET and conventional FinFET. Numerical simulation results shows that TMG FinFET exhibits significantly improved performance in terms of surface potential, electric field and carrier velocity distribution.
